I have a 2001 F150 SuperCrew. As an option, some of them came from Ford with an Audio/Visual option that mounted from the cab and had a fold down screen. Ford is mighty proud of their version and subsequently are asking about 1250.00 as an option installed from the factory.
Does ANYBODY know of a suitable aftermarket brand that will not void my warranty? I like the idea of having the unit permanently mounted within the vehicle, but am not totally sold on the idea.

[updated:LAST EDITED ON 01-Aug-02 AT 12:14 PM (EST)]Sorry Johnny,
Should have told you the first time. It came from Ford with the video package.
I wanted one in my Crew, but with the sunroof it wasn't an option.
But at a boat show I went to last February There was a place that has the vidio units you can purchase that hang like a back pack over the two front seats and the unit is suspended between the seats. It looked like a quality setup.
Beleive it or not I've seen these units at a Myers store.
If you have a car audio place where you live that do sterio modifications and things like that, they can probably do it.
I've seen them priced from $550.00 to $1000.00.
The one in my van is a VCP player. It plays Vhs tapes only, you can't record or anything like a VCR.

I'm thinking about getting the Sony A/V Receiver for my truck. From my understanding, it's not an overhead unit, it's an in-dash unit. It has a 7" motorized screen, it looks like a regular radio when closed.
It sounds pretty good for me because I want to upgrade my audio system and get a video system, and this does both. Summit has it for $999.95. Here's a quote from the magazine:

"This Sony A/V receiver is versatile enough to serve as the source unit for TV, CD, DVD, MP3, and XM-Radio! It incorporates a motorized 7" video monitor which doubles as an audio display. Plus, it has two auxillary audio/video inputs, so you can add a VCR, Playstation, or other accessories. The receiver delivers 45 watts x 4 channel power and includes CD/MD changer control, EQ7 seven band equalizer and Dynamic Soundstage."

Summit also has quite a few other a/v systems if you're not interested in this.
